Description

Diiodoacetonitrile is a versatile halogenated organic compound with the CAS number 959961-04-7, serving as a critical building block in advanced chemical synthesis. Its unique structure, featuring two iodine atoms on an acetonitrile backbone, makes it a valuable reagent for introducing iodine functional groups and constructing complex molecular architectures. This compound is essential for researchers and process chemists in the pharmaceutical, agrochemical, and specialty chemical industries, where it is used to develop new active ingredients and functional materials.

Basic Information

Product Name Diiodoacetonitrile
CAS No. 959961-04-7
Molecular Formula C2HI2N
Molecular Weight 292.84 g/mol
Synonyms Acetonitrile, diiodo-; Diiodomethyl cyanide; Iodoacetonitrile, di-; 2,2-Diiodoacetonitrile; Cyanodiiodomethane; Diiodoethanenitrile

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at room temperature (15-25°C). Keep away from heat, sparks, and open flame. Due to its light-sensitive nature, containers should be kept in amber glass or opaque packaging. Handle and store under an inert atmosphere if prolonged storage is required to maintain optimal purity.
